Locating and Eliminating Hidden Leaks

Pinpointing a hidden water intrusion can feel like searching for a needle in a haystack. However, with a systematic method and keen observation, you can spot these sneaky culprits before they cause significant destruction. Start your investigation by thoroughly inspecting areas where leaks are most common, such as around water sources, pipes, and connections. Look for indications of water damage on walls, ceilings, and floors. Moreover, pay attention to musty smells which can indicate a hidden leak.
Utilize your senses: listen for dripping noises, feel for dampness, and even look for changes in water volume. Once you've identified the potential source of the leak, it's time to take action.
Fix any compromised pipes or connections promptly. For larger leaks, it's best to consult a qualified professional. They have the expertise and tools to efficiently locate and eliminate hidden leaks, preventing further damage to your property and ensuring a safe and comfortable living environment.

Pinpointing Water Leaks with Precision
Water leaks can be a significant problem, causing damage to your property and increasing your water bills. Thankfully, there are several techniques available to effectively pinpoint the location of a leak. One common method is to meticulously inspect your plumbing system for any visible signs of water damage or leaks. This includes checking pipes under sinks, around toilets, and in basements or crawl spaces. Furthermore, you can use specialized tools, such as a leak detector, to identify the presence of moisture in hidden areas. These devices work by detecting changes in electrical conductivity caused by humidity. By tracking the readings provided by the leak detector, you can pinpoint the source of the leak with improved accuracy. Besides, it's helpful to observe your water meter readings over time. A sudden increase in water usage could indicate a leak, even if you can't immediately identify the source.
